Brands
The brand you choose will influence the price you pay. Different companies charge different prices for their products. Certain manufacturers make cheaper scooters while others create high-end models which can cost over $5,000. The price of a mobility scoot is influenced by a variety of factors such as the type and size of the motor, battery, wheels, and where to buy mobility scooter accessories.
The top scooter brands offer excellent customer service and a broad range of options for their customers. Some brands offer financing to aid in the cost of initial purchases. You can also test out the scooter prior to purchasing it.
Pride Mobility has been in business since 1986 and is among the most well-known brands in the field. Their range of products includes scooters, power chairs, and other medical equipment that is durable. The company has over 30 locations in the US. It is headquartered in Pennsylvania. Their scooters have various features, including an swivel-seat and lightweight frames. The company offers a lifetime frame guarantee and two-year warranty on the electronics and powertrain.
Drive Medical is a popular brand of scooter that can be found at a wide range of local medical supply stores. The company is a specialist in travel and compact scooters, which are ideal for use at home or for short excursions. The models of the company are ideal for older adults suffering from hip or back issues. The company also has various specific features that make its scooters suitable for those who have limited mobility.
Another option worth considering is EV Rider which provides many different scooters that can be used for a variety of mobility requirements. The company's sports-style scooters are popular with those who are looking for the best scooter that is not only functional, but also stylish. The company has a solid presence in the online market and offers top-quality customer service.
Prices are a bit higher than usual.
The price of a mobility scooter may differ depending on the model size, the features, and the size. Certain models feature more advanced technology and are more expensive than others. The best way to choose the best scooter is to identify what your needs are and decide which features are most important to you. You should also think about how often you'll utilize the scooter and where to buy mobility scooter you will be using it most frequently. For instance, if you will be taking it on trips, you should choose an option that easily folds and fits in the trunk of your car.
The number of wheels on a scooter also affects the price. Four-wheel scooters are more stable than three-wheel models and are suited for riding on uneven terrain. They can also carry more weight and are less likely tip. They tend to be more expensive than travel or folding scooters.
When choosing a mobility vehicle take into consideration the battery's life span and maximum speed. The more powerful the speed, the quicker you'll be able to travel. Consider whether you would like to add extra features to your scooter such as a bag or rearview mirror. Although most scooters come with these accessories but some seniors would prefer to upgrade their machines with more convenient features. However, it is important to keep in mind that Medicare only pays for certain features on the scooter if they're considered to be medically necessary and essential.

A mobility scooter is an electronic vehicle that can be operated by one person. It was created to assist those with limited physical capabilities. They are usually powered by batteries and have three or four wheels. The handlebar is used to control the scooter. They can be ridden either on pavements, sidewalks or roads based on their speed. Many scooters are equipped with baskets along with lights and a sounder. Some scooters can fold up to make transporting more convenient.
Choosing the right scooter for you is based on your preferences and requirements. When making a decision, you should consider the following aspects including the maximum speed, the turning radius, as well as the capacity for weight of the scooter. The turning radius is the amount of time the scooter can turn in one direction. The capacity of the weight is the maximum amount of weight the scooter can carry. The maximum speed of a scooter can vary, depending on the terrain, the incline and the weight of the passenger.
The majority of literature on mobility scooters focuses on their use and prevalence within the population. There are however a few studies that study the physical function and physical capability impacts of mobility scooter use. These studies suggest that the usage of a mobility device can help people maintain their independence in walking and maintain their ability to walk as they did prior to utilizing the device.
It is important to consider the limitations of using a mobility scooter. For instance they may not be suitable in public buildings. This is especially true for older buildings that weren't designed with accessibility in mind. They may also be unable to maneuver through narrow hallways or the "privacy wall" in the majority of washrooms. Therefore, it is advised that a medical exam be conducted prior to purchasing a mobility scooter to ensure it meets the individual's physical and medical requirements.
